go 交叉编译

widnow 交叉编译linux可运行二进制

set GOOS=linux
set GOPACH=amd64
go build main.go

扔到服务器

rz 选择文件
chmod +x  main   
./main

--PS

这时ssh关了就gg了。我们把它写到服务器进程里

./main &

后面加个&

更新补充:

ssh关闭后这个进程也跟着关闭了。这个是由于直接关闭ssh连接导致了,可以exit出去连接再关闭ssh。这时候就是正常的。

--END--

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• Golang 支持交叉编译,在一个平台上生成另一个平台的可执行程序,最近使用了一下,非常好用,这里备忘一下。 Ma...
    Dr點燃阅读 910评论 0 3
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 136,490评论 19 139
  • 1、交叉编译 由于嵌入式系统资源匮乏,一般不能像 PC 一样安装本地编译器和调试器,不能在本地编写、编译和调...
    不配野心阅读 2,236评论 0 4
  • PHP官网www.php.net 当前主流版本为5.6/7.1 cd /usr/local/src/ wget h...
    AMZ小楼阅读 278评论 0 0
  • 湘江北去,衡阳雁回,夏的余热还未散尽,秋的前兆未现端倪,在这季节的间隙里,我们匆匆收拾好行囊,踏上远行的列车,挥师...
    一默经年阅读 5,782评论 2 5

友情链接更多精彩内容